        | WILLIAM POTTER | 
        *1865 - 1866 | 
       
		
        Beerhouse keeper accused 
		Monday 28th August 1865 of having house open at illegal hours. Evidence 
		so contradictory that perjury must have been committed by one side or he 
		other. Case adjourned for the production of other witnesses.  
		To be continued..... | 
       
		
        | Monday 14th May 1866 - Committed to one 
		month in prison for stealing a basket of cockles, value 1s, the property 
		of Isaac Whiting. |

	For sale by auction, at the house of Mr. Bull, the Black Horse, Brancaster 
	2nd January 1832. 
	`Freehold Estate in Brancaster Town, next the public road 
	leading from Burnham to * Ditchwell, (Tichwell?) in the occupation of 
	Mrs Elizabeth Chidwick and others; consisting of a good substantial 
	dwelling-house, in good trade, known by the sign of the Black Horse, with 
	Stable and out offices; Also a General Retail Shop, Butchers Shop, and 
	Barn......' 
	 
	 
	Location as High Street 1841 & Main Street 1891. 
	 
	Location as Staithe 1879 to 1933 
	 
    Licence not renewed 9th February 1959 
    Premises sold
